Abstract

A five dimensional Kaluza-Klein dark energy model with variable EoS parameter is investigated in the scale co-variant theory of gravitation proposed by Canuto et al. (in Phys. Rev. 39:429, 1977) in a five dimensional Kaluza-Klein space-time in the presence of perfect fluid source. Using the special law of variation for Hubble’s parameter proposed by Berman (in Nuovo Cimento B 74:183, 1983), we have obtained a determinate solution which represents a dark energy cosmological model in the theory. We have also used the result that the scalar expansion is proportional to shear scalar of the space-time. It is observed that the EoS parameter, skewness parameter in the model turn out to be functions of cosmic time. Some physical and Kinematical properties of the model are also discussed.
